On Friday (13th) we visited Britz 4×4 Rentals to look at a vehicle and the Toyota Hilux with two tents seems to be the one we would like to rent. You can see what we are talking about by visiting http://www.britz.co.za/5.Our_4_X_4_Vehicles.html Living in South Africa makes the price lower for us than an overseas person and also it is off season. Our only question was about space for luggage because the vehicle is equipped with the on-top tents a kitchen which includes a very small fridge, stove and gas bottle and a built in water container. There is also other camping equipment like a table and chairs and then two spare wheels and a bumper jack. We can also rent a porta-loo which Rose I thinks will be handy. The question some may have is why rent instead of buying something. That is because this is a fact-finding trip which will let us know we have the stamina for trips like this and for us to see the needs and ways we can meet them.

February 12, 2009 by royandroseThe first practical thing we need is a 4×4 vehicle because some of the roads we are traveling on will be rough. The trip will be in the dry season so we should not encounter mud only sand and large potholes. That is why a conventional car would find it difficult to negotiate some of the terrain although with the roads they way they are you can travel long distances in a normal car these days. Most of the time we will be staying with friends but will need to camp at times so we have been looking at renting a 4×4 Toyota Hilux that has a tent on top of the cab simular to the one in the picture.
